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: 1. >18 years old 2. Presence of a single osseointegrated implant with horizontal volumetric deficiency 3. Full-mouth plaque score (FMPS) <25%
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: 1. Presence of vertical defects 2. Palate thickness 7%) 4. Current chemotherapy or radiotherapy treatment 5. Immunocompromised status 6. Pregnancy or lactation 7. Smoking >10 cigarettes/day 8. Previous bone augmentation in the treatment area 9. Active periodontal disease or local inflammation and/or infection 10. Known hypersensitivity to porcine-derived materials
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Volumetric augmentation measured using a digital scan at baseline, 3 months, 6 months, and 1 year post-intervention | — |
Secondary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| 1. Keratinized tissue width measured using a graduated periodontal probe and Lugol's solution at baseline, 3 months, 6 months, and 1 year post-intervention 2. Aesthetic outcomes measured using the Pink Esthetic Score (PES) at baseline, 3 months, 6 months, and 1 year post-intervention 3. Patient Reported Outcome Measures (PROMs) including: 3.1. Postoperative pain measured using a Visual Analogue Scale (VAS) at 6 hours post-intervention, twice daily for the first 5 days, followed by once daily until 14 days postoperatively 3.2. The need of rescue medication, measured using a questionnaire twice daily for the first 5 days, followed by once daily until 14 days postoperatively 3.3. Oral health-related quality of life using the Oral Health Impact Profile-14 (OHIP-14) questionnaire at day 7 post-intervention 3.4. Postoperative bleeding measured using a questionnaire at day 7 post-intervention | — |
